引言
在网络的日常使用中,尤其是使用V2Ray等翻墙工具时,经常会遇到TCP协议被墙的情况。此类问题影响了很多使用者的网络访问体验,导致无法稳定地访问国外的网站和应用。本文将围绕V2Ray TCP被墙的问题进行深入分析,并提供一些针对性的解决方案。
V2Ray简介
V2Ray是一个功能强大的网络代理工具,其设计目的是帮助用户在网络环境中更有效地进行信息传输。就其核心而言,V2Ray提供了多种协议的支持,包括TCP、TLS、WebSocket等。其灵活的配置和良好的性能使其在科学上网的领域广受欢迎。
V2Ray的工作原理
- 中转协议: V2Ray通过一种或者多种自定义协议来实现对数据包的转发。
- 传输加密: 确保网络数据不会被第三方轻易窃取。
- 多种传输方式: 支持TCP、mKCP、WebSocket等,可以根据情况选择合适的协议。
V2Ray TCP被墙的原因
在某些国家或地区,V2Ray的TCP连接可能会被防火墙检测并阻断,具体原因可能包括:
- 深度包检测(DPI): 一些互联网服务提供商采用深度包检测技术来识别V2Ray网络流量。
- IP封锁: V2Ray服务器的IP地址可能因为违规被整块封锁。
- 协议特征识别: TCP协议本身的特征可能会向服务器暴露出数据类型,从而被识别。
如何判断TCP是否被墙
在判断V2Ray TCP是否被墙时,可以通过以下几种方法来测试:
- Ping测试: 使用ping命令检查V2Ray服务器是否可以连接。
- Traceroute: 使用traceroute命令查看数据路径是否正常。
- 使用不同代理协议: 尝试不同的V2Ray传输协议测试连接。
应对TCP被墙的解决方案
当发现V2Ray TCP被墙,用户可以采取以下几种解决方案:
1. 更改传输协议
- WebSocket 或者 mKCP协议可能在墙的监测下表现更好。可以在V2Ray的配置文件中进行相应修改。
2. 使用TLS加密
- 在V2Ray中配置使用TLS进行加密连接,使数据包看起来不易被识别,从而可能减少被墙的可能性。
3. 选择合适的端口
- V2Ray的默认端口可能被墙,用户可以尝试使用其他不常用的端口如443、80、或者随机端口等。
4. 池化服务器
- 多个可用的V2Ray服务器可以预留用作 备份 服务器。如果一个服务器被墙则切换到其他服务器。
5. 使用混淆技术
- 为V2Ray的数据传输增加特定的混淆iftinging技术虑,这样即使被DPI检查时也能降低被识别的可能。
FAQ
V2Ray TCP连接被墙后,我应该怎么办?
首先,尝试更换传输协议如WebSocket或mKCP,然后检查服务器的连接状况,如必需更换服务器。
为什么V2Ray的TCP连接会被墙?
深度包检测(DPI),服务提供商监控流量,以及ID封锁都是常见的被墙原因。
有哪些方法直接能提升V2Ray的逃避能力?
可以使用TLS加密、变更常用端口、使用混淆等手段来提升逃避能力。
如果无法解决TCP被墙问题,我还可以使用什么工具?
可以考虑其他翻墙工具,如Shadowsocks、Trojan等,它们在不同环境下可能有更好的表现。
总结
在当前的网络环境下,V2Ray的TCP被墙现象越来越普遍,影响用户的上网体验。通过上述的解决方法和技巧,用户可以在一定程度上减少TCP被墙的问题,提高自己网络访问的稳定性和安全性。希望本文对您有所帮助,对于在使用V2Ray时的相关问题能够提供参考。
正文完